VMware虚拟机添加物理硬盘教程
vmware虚拟机增加物理硬盘

首页 2025-03-20 16:45:13



VMware虚拟机增加物理硬盘:全面指南与实战解析 在虚拟化技术日益成熟的今天,VMware作为业界的领头羊,为企业和个人用户提供了强大的虚拟化解决方案

    随着业务需求的不断增长,虚拟机(VM)的存储需求也随之增加

    因此,如何在VMware虚拟机中增加物理硬盘,成为了一个备受关注的问题

    本文将从理论基础、操作步骤、性能优化及注意事项等多个方面,为您全面解析这一重要操作

     一、引言:理解虚拟机与物理硬盘的关系 虚拟机(Virtual Machine)是一种通过软件模拟出的具有完整硬件系统功能的计算环境

    在VMware等虚拟化平台上,虚拟机可以运行自己的操作系统和应用程序,仿佛是一台独立的物理计算机

    而物理硬盘,则是实际存在于服务器或工作站中的存储设备,用于存储虚拟机文件、操作系统、应用程序数据等

     在虚拟化环境中,虚拟机通过虚拟磁盘文件(如VMDK)与物理硬盘进行交互

    当虚拟机需要更多存储空间时,我们可以通过增加虚拟磁盘文件的大小、添加新的虚拟磁盘,或者直接将物理硬盘资源分配给虚拟机来实现存储扩展

    本文将重点讨论如何通过VMware平台,将物理硬盘资源有效地分配给虚拟机

     二、准备工作:确保环境安全与资源充足 在进行任何涉及虚拟机存储配置的操作之前,确保以下几点至关重要: 1.备份数据:无论是对虚拟机进行任何配置更改,还是增加物理硬盘,都应事先备份所有重要数据

    以防万一操作失误导致数据丢失

     2.评估资源:检查物理服务器的硬件资源,确保有足够的物理硬盘空间、I/O性能以及适当的RAID配置来满足新增存储需求

     3.规划布局:根据业务需求规划存储布局,决定是添加新硬盘还是利用现有未分配空间,以及新硬盘的分区、文件系统类型等

     4.权限验证:确保执行操作的账户拥有足够的权限,能够访问VMware vSphere Client或vCenter Server,并能够对虚拟机进行配置更改

     三、实战操作:VMware虚拟机增加物理硬盘 3.1 方法一:通过vSphere Client添加物理RDM(Raw Device Mapping) Raw Device Mapping(RDM)允许虚拟机直接访问物理存储设备,而不是通过虚拟磁盘文件

    这种方法适用于高性能需求场景,如数据库服务器

     步骤: 1.连接物理硬盘:首先,将新的物理硬盘连接到物理服务器上,并确保其在BIOS/UEFI中被识别

     2.配置RDM: - 登录vSphere Client

     - 选择目标虚拟机,进入“配置”选项卡

     - 在“硬件”部分,点击“添加新硬件”,选择“硬盘”

     - 在硬盘类型中选择“RDM - 物理兼容模式”或“RDM - 虚拟兼容模式”(根据需求选择)

     - 选择物理硬盘,并完成向导配置

     3.格式化与挂载: - 启动虚拟机,进入操作系统

     - 使用磁盘管理工具(如Windows的磁盘管理或Linux的fdisk/parted)识别并初始化新添加的RDM磁盘

     - 根据需求进行分区、格式化,并挂载到文件系统中

     3.2 方法二:通过vSphere Storage DRS动态分配存储空间 vSphere Storage DRS(Distributed Resource Scheduler)可以自动在存储集群中平衡虚拟机的存储负载,包括动态添加存储空间

     步骤: 1.配置存储集群:确保你的存储资源已加入vSphere Storage DRS集群

     2.增加物理存储:将新的物理硬盘或存储阵列添加到vSAN或存储集群中

     3.启用Storage DRS自动化:在vCenter Server中,为存储集群启用Storage DRS自动化级别(如“完全自动化”)

     4.虚拟机存储迁移: - 在vSphere Client中,选择目标虚拟机

     - 使用“存储”->“迁移”功能,将虚拟机的存储迁移到包含新物理硬盘的存储集群上

     - 根据Storage DRS的策略,虚拟机将自动利用新添加的存储空间

     3.3 方法三:通过vSAN增加分布式存储 vSAN(Virtual SAN)是VMware提供的软件定义存储解决方案,支持虚拟机存储的动态扩展

     步骤: 1.准备vSAN节点:确保所有参与vSAN的ESXi主机都已安装vSAN许可证,并满足vSAN硬件要求

     2.添加物理硬盘到vSAN:将新的物理硬盘添加到参与vSAN的ESXi主机上,并在vSAN配置中将其标记为数据存储磁盘

     3.扩展vSAN集群:在vCenter Server中,通过vSAN配置向导,将新硬盘加入vSAN集群,实现存储容量的增加

     4.虚拟机存储策略调整: - 为虚拟机设置或调整存储策略,确保其能够利用vSAN集群中的新增存储空间

     - 根据策略,vSAN将自动管理虚拟机的数据存储位置,包括在新硬盘上的分布

     四、性能优化与监控 增加物理硬盘后,为确保虚拟机性能不受影响,还需进行一系列性能优化与监控措施: 1.I/O负载均衡:利用VMware的存储I/O控制(Storage I/O Control)功能,防止单个虚拟机占用过多I/O资源,影响整体性能

     2.缓存策略调整:根据工作负载特性,调整VMware缓存策略,如启用或禁用写回缓存,以提高读写性能

     3.性能监控:使用vSphere的性能监控工具(如vCenter Operations Manager、vRealize Operations等),持续监控虚拟机的存储性能,及时发现并解决瓶颈问题

     4.定期维护:定期对存储系统进行维护,如碎片整理、健康检查等,保持存储性能稳定

     五、注意事项与最佳实践 1.兼容性检查:在添加物理硬盘或进行存储配置更改前,务必检查硬件与软件的兼容性,避免不兼容导致的问题

     2.逐步实施:对于生产环境中的虚拟机,建议采用逐步实施策略,先在小范围测试环境中验证,再逐步推广到生产环境

     3.文档记录:详细记录每一步操作、配置参数及遇到的问题与解决方案,便于后续维护与故障排查

     4.培训与支持:确保运维团队熟悉VMware虚拟化技术,了解存储配置的最佳实践,并能有效利用VMware官方文档与社区资源解决问题

     六、结语 通过VMware平台为虚拟机增加物理硬盘,不仅能够满足日益增长的存储需求,还能在性能优化、资源管理方面带来诸多优势

    然而,这一过程需要严谨的准备、精细的操作以及持续的监控与优化

    本文提供的全面指南与实战解析,旨在帮助您高效、安全地完成这一任务,为虚拟机的稳定运行和业务连续性提供坚实保障

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道